UAE President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an has ordered the release of 870 prisoners ahead of the country’s 50th National Day.
The move is part of the President’s keenness to accord pardoned inmates an opportunity to start a new life, official news agency WAM reported.
The prisoners – sentenced for various crimes – will also have their debts and fines paid-off.
Meanwhile, in a similar move, Sheikh Humaid bin Rashid Al Nuaimi, Supreme Council Member and Ruler of Ajman, also issued the release order of 43 prisoners.
All the pardoned prisoners demonstrated good conduct during their sentences.
